The singer has racked up 15 Grammy wins since rising to prominence in the late 2000s and most recently made her highly-anticipated return "Easy on Me," the first single from her upcoming album "30." On Thursday night she dropped her first single in almost six years, and revealed the inspiration behind her lyrics – divorce and her pursuit of happiness. In various interviews, Adele dug into how her divorce from Simon Konecki and her relationship to their son, Angelo, influenced her new album. Almost three years after her divorce, she's telling her side of the story to her son and all of us through her music. "I feel like this album is self-destruction, then self-reflection and then sort of self-redemption," she told Vogue. "But I feel ready. I really want people to hear my side of the story this time." "Go easy on me, baby," she sings. "I was still a child / Didn't get the chance to feel the world around me / Had no time to choose what I chose to do / So go easy on me." "Easy on Me" comes a day after Adele announced on social media she's "ready to finally" release "30" on Nov. 19.
